I was surprised it has taken this long for the Swans to be mentioned as potential suitor for West since Mumford agreed to terms with GWS. Their ruck stocks are Pyke who is 29, and Naismith who is 21 & yet to play a game. Tippet can play in the ruck, but surely they don't want to risk a situation where Pyke goes down for a few weeks and they have to rely on Tippet.
